Multifunctional hand ventilation binding device with grip rehabilitation function
Technical Field
The utility model relates to the technical field of medical restraint instruments, in particular to a grip strength rehabilitation type multifunctional hand ventilation restraint device.
Background
In medical work, the restraint device is commonly used for diagnosis and treatment of patients with children, psychosis and the like, so that the effects of improving the coordination degree and avoiding affecting the work of medical staff are achieved. Common restraint devices include restraint garments, restraint beds, and the like, and also hand restraint devices are commonly used in a variety of medical applications, such as to prevent a patient from pulling out a tube or other accident while the patient is performing a cannula, surgery, or examination, and the like, thereby restraining the patient's hand. Traditional hand constraint device is mostly the form of gloves, with its constraint and bed body both sides, avoids the patient to scratch, but among the prior art, along with constraint time extension, patient's hand can not grasp, is unfavorable for the normal blood system of finger, and air permeability is poor, also operations such as inconvenient infusion, and it is comparatively loaded down with trivial details to use the dismantlement.

Detailed Description
As in fig. 1-3, the multi-functional ventilative constraint device of hand of grip rehabilitation formula, including constraint structure, constraint structure include layer board 1, layer board 1 is connected with screen panel 3 through zip fastener structure 2, is equipped with wrist strap 4 on layer board 1 and the screen panel 3, is equipped with buckle strap 5 and a plurality of snap fastener sockets 6 rather than the complex on the wrist strap 4, is equipped with movable groove 8 on layer board 1, movable groove 8 is connected with grip exercise ring 10 through connector 9, wrist strap 4 is connected with fixed limit structure.
In the preferred scheme, fixed limit structure include shell 11, be equipped with a plurality of locating holes 12, opening 13 and first fixed cover 20 on the shell 11, first fixed cover 20 is articulated with second fixed cover 22 through round pin axle 21, first fixed cover 20 is through a plurality of locking screw 23 and the fixed cover 22 locking cooperation of second, be equipped with wire winding rotary drum 14 in the shell 1, wire winding rotary drum 14 is connected with the one end of spacing area 19, the other end and the first wrist cover 4 of spacing area 19 are connected, be equipped with rotation handle 15 and spacing slide bar 16 on the wire winding rotary drum 14, the one end and the wire winding rotary drum 14 slip spacing cooperation of spacing slide bar 16, the other end of spacing slide bar 16 is equipped with the spacing bulge 17 with locating hole 12 complex, the cover has spring 18 on the spacing slide bar 16, the both ends of spring 18 are connected with wire winding rotary drum 14 and spacing bulge 17 respectively. The binding distance is convenient to adjust, flexible to control and convenient to disassemble and assemble.
In a preferred embodiment, the first and second fixing sleeves 20 and 22 are provided with anti-slip pads 24. The anti-skid effect is good, and the fixation is firm.
In the preferred scheme, the net cover 3 is provided with an opening and closing cover 7. The hand transfusion matching is convenient, and the practicability is strong.
In the preferred scheme, the wrist strap 4 is made of medical silica gel. Good elasticity and high strength, and can avoid hurting the wrist.
The application method of the utility model comprises the following steps: the hand of the patient is placed on the supporting plate 1, then the hand is covered by the net cover 3 in a turnover mode, then the first wrist sleeve 4 and the second wrist sleeve 5 are fixed on the wrist part by using the magic tape 6, the net cover 3 and the supporting plate 1 are connected by pulling the zipper structure 2, the stretching length of the limiting belt 19 is adjusted according to the limiting requirement of constraint, the hand constraint is realized by matching and locking the limiting raised head 17 and the positioning hole 12, and when the hand constraint is realized for a long time, the function of promoting the blood circulation of fingers is achieved by repeatedly holding the grip strength exercise ring 10, so that the normal blood circulation is kept.
